FYI: Friends and Seinfeld exist in the same universe.


One year during sweeps week, NBC tried to do a running plot in all of their Thursday night shows where there was a blackout in NYC. In friends, it’s the episode where chandler is trapped in the ATM vestibule with the model. They wanted some shows to cross over. Larry David and Jerry Seinfeld said they’d only do it if they could kill off Ross on Seinfeld. They said no and Seinfeld wasn’t a part of the running blackout plot.
